Global access to information The Documentum EDMS is a family of open, client/server software products designed to handle business-critical collaborative documents and processes. Documentum's robust server manages the many data types and their associated work processes involved in producing complex documents such as engineering proposals (often thousands of pages long, each costing over a million dollars in labor alone), and the procurement of materials. Black and Veatch will use Documentum's EDMS to increase global access to information in order to significantly reduce the overall time spent creating future proposals by leveraging existing intellectual capital. Docobjects can range from text to tables to graphics, giving users the flexibility to incorporate all data types into a virtual document -- in which a unique document can be assembled at any time from any source. The ability to create Virtual Documents on demand enables Black and Veatch to leverage its corporate knowledge in order to accelerate the entire process, from proposal to construction. "By implementing Documentum across the organization, we will be able to increase the quality of the documents and reduce the review and approval time, ultimately eliminating months from our product life cycle," predicted Hart. The entire Documentum EDMS Release 2.0 includes: the Documentum Workspace, a graphical user environment; the Documentum Server, featuring library services and workflow; and the Documentum Toolkit, a set of APIs for building custom solutions. About Documentum Headquartered in Pleasanton, Documentum sells the Documentum Enterprise Document Management System through a direct sales force, systems integrators and affiliated distributors in Canada and Europe. The company was founded in 1990 to offer a new class of enterprise document management applications that provide dramatic improvement in business-critical document processes. The Documentum EDMS is the first family of open, client/server software products that can be tailored to specific enterprise document applications. Documentum has more than 100 customer sites in pharmaceutical, manufacturing, regulatory and government applications around the world.
